@🍄The Mad Philosopher🍄 in reference to your image, Islamic extremism went back a long way. It didn't start because of America, but in fact it is a cycle. What cycle? Well, between religious fanaticism and western dictatorship. It reached it's high point when the Entente split the Middle East as mandates after World War One. They planned to do the same to Turkey, but failed because of an extraordinary gentleman. These Mandates (Syria and Iraq) went on to become dictatorships, taking inspiration from the western model. Saddam Hussein himself attempted to connect his regime to the old Babylonians, which angered many Muslims.
The British actually promised to give the Hejazis (a group in Arabia) their own western Arabian kingdom, effectively controlling the gulf states, Iraq, Syria, and Saudi Arabia. However, the British did not live up to this. The more powerful House of Saud went on to take control of most of Arabia.
